Driveshaft Realignment
I have the drive shaft and rear axle off at the moment and read in my shop manual that the drive shaft is balanced so that it should be attached a certain way to the rear axle. In other words you can hook it up 180 degrees off and it will cause the driveshaft to vibrate excessively. I have already removed them both and did not mark which side of the U joint on the driveshaft met up with which side on the rear axle hookup. Is there any way to know how it is supposed to go now that they are separated? My guess is that trial and error will tell me the proper alignment by the amount of vibration. Will it hurt anything if it is put on 180 deg. off to test? Any help would be appreciated.
